Developer - ROLAP

Engineering Brno, Czech Republic

GoodData is the embedded analytic leader. Help us develop the top analytic software.

We are constantly iterating, designing, and coding our way to excellence. If you're an enthusiastic and talented engineer who wants to work in a team of talented, driven individuals then we'd love to hear from you.

We are expanding our team dedicated to the back-end of our unique analytical platform, designed for creating analytical data products for our customers. We are seeking an experienced professional who not only is familiar with backend development but who is also able to contribute to architecture and the design of distributed software using agile methodologies.

Your responsibilities would be:

  • Design, implement, and maintain applications, tools and utilities for the backend services and components which are the core of the GoodData platform
  • Be able to contribute also to other parts of the platform, learn new technologies and environments
  • Participate in the ongoing evolution of fast growing cloud SaaS platform
  • Work in an agile environment, with the cooperation and active communication within an autonomous team
  • Be involved in all stages of development lifecycle (architecture, coding, QA, delivery, ...)

Required skills:

  • Strong will to learn new technologies
  • Ability to work effectively in a Linux environment is a must
  • Strong knowledge of at least one dynamic language (Ruby, Python, PHP), will to learn new ones
  • At least 2 years of experience with software development, or operations and/or adequate university degree
  • A self-learner capable of independent work
  • Active English (spoken and written)


  • Knowledge of SQL, experience with PostgreSQL and MySQL
  • Experience with other programming languages (Kotlin, Java, TypeScript)
  • An overview of agile methodologies 
  • Contribution to or maintaintenance of an open source project
  • Experience with building and operating large distributed systems
  • Experience with Kubernetes, Docker
  • Experience with Puppet
  • DevOps attitude

Extra Goodies:

  • informal working environment and fun company culture
  • annual bonuses
  • stock options
  • flexible working hours
  • your choice of MacBook or Lenovo laptop
  • 25 days of vacation + 6 sick days
  • generous referral bonus program
  • lunch vouchers
  • employee mobile tariff
  • relax zones, gym, sports program 'GoodLife'
  • regular company pub evenings and social events
  • fridges full of free refreshments, and more